Worlds fastest supercomputer runs linux

"IBM and Los Alamos National Laboratory break a processing speed record with the world's first petaflop computer, Roadrunner " - Wikipedia

 

I had to look up what a petaflop is, and I still don't quite get it, but I think I 've grasped it enough to know that it's really fast (10 to the power of 15 flops - a calculator averages about 10 flops).  read more »

Progressive Rehabilitation Methods?

I caught a little snippet in the London Free Press the other day about a video on youtube that has been getting a lot of attention as of late and decided to investigate a little.

The video, uploaded by a prison worker in Cebu Provincial Detention and Rehabilitation Center in Cebu, Philippines, shows about 1,500 inmates doing a choreographed dance routine to Michael Jackson's "Thriller".

...and it's actually quite good.

The CPDRC stars (many in jail for drug charges) have become quite popular on Youtube and have done several other videos, a few to the music from Whoopi Goldberg's "Sister Act", a Japanese algorithm march and even one to the Black Eyed Peas!!  read more »
